Removal and Installation
1. |
Disconnect the battery negative terminal.
|
2. |
Disconnect the rear oxygen sensor connector (A).
|
3. |
Remove the front muffler (A).
|
4. |
Remove the catalytic converter & center muffler assembly
(A).
|
5. |
Remove the main muffler (A).
|
6. |
Installation is the reverse order of removal.
